Finding Work Opportunities

Now that you have a basic understanding of the industry, it’s time to find work opportunities. Here are some ways to locate companies that hire individuals to assemble products at home:

  • Online job boards: Websites like Indeed, Upwork, and Freelancer offer a variety of assembly jobs.

  • Company websites: Many companies list their product assembly opportunities on their official websites.

  • Networking: Reach out to friends, family, and colleagues to see if they know of any companies hiring for assembly work.

  • Local businesses: Check with local manufacturers and distributors to see if they have any assembly opportunities.

Setting Up Your Workspace

Creating a dedicated workspace is crucial for successful product assembly. Here are some tips to help you set up your home office:

  • Choose a quiet and well-lit area: A peaceful environment will help you focus on your work.

  • Organize your workspace: Keep your tools, materials, and products in an orderly fashion to avoid clutter.

  • Invest in the right equipment: Ensure you have the necessary tools and materials to complete the assembly tasks.

  • Stay organized: Keep track of your orders, deadlines, and payments to stay on top of your work.

Training and Quality Control

Many companies require you to complete training before starting work. This ensures that you understand the product specifications and quality control standards. Here are some tips to help you excel in training and maintain high-quality work:

  • Pay attention to detail: Pay close attention to the product specifications and follow instructions carefully.

  • Ask questions: Don’t hesitate to ask your employer or supervisor for clarification if you’re unsure about a task.

  • Stay consistent: Maintain a consistent and high-quality output throughout your work.

  • Seek feedback: Ask for feedback from your employer or supervisor to improve your skills.
